Where each one falls short

Documented limitations, not opinions. Every one is a constraint you would hit in normal use.

HTC Vive

  • Requires large dedicated play space, limiting adoption for apartment living or small offices
  • PC-tethered models require powerful gaming PC ($1000+ investment) for satisfactory performance
  • Hardware setup involves multiple power outlets (5 total: two controllers, two base stations, one bridge)
  • Consumer gaming content library for Vive is limited compared to Oculus/Meta ecosystem

ARKit

  • iOS-only platform, not available for Android or other operating systems
  • Location-based AR accuracy limited to 3-5 meters, insufficient for precise applications
  • Cannot handle very fast motion capture
  • Accuracy varies with lighting conditions and surface characteristics
  • Requires iOS 11 or later and specific device hardware

HTC Vive: What PC power is required to run HTC Vive headsets?

HTC Vive requires a gaming-capable PC with significant processing power. PC requirements vary by model and content, but minimum specs typically include Intel i5/Ryzen 5 processor, GTX 1070 or RTX 2060 graphics, and 8GB RAM for smooth gameplay.

ARKit: Is ARKit free to use?

Yes, ARKit is free to use. It is included in Apple's iOS SDK and requires only Xcode and a Mac to start building AR apps. There are no licensing fees or subscription costs.

HTC Vive: Does HTC Vive work with existing Steam VR games?

Yes. HTC Vive implements SteamVR platform and supports all games and software that use SteamVR, giving access to the full Steam VR library.

ARKit: What iOS devices support ARKit?

ARKit is supported on iPhone 6s and later, iPad Pro models, and the latest iPad models. It requires iOS 11 or later. Apple Vision Pro also supports ARKit with enhanced capabilities through visionOS.

HTC Vive: Can HTC Vive be used for enterprise applications beyond gaming?

Yes. Since 2021, HTC has targeted the Vive line toward business and enterprise markets with tools for training, simulation, design visualization, and collaborative work environments. The VIVE Developer platform provides SDKs for custom enterprise applications.

ARKit: Can ARKit work offline?

ARKit can function offline for tracking and scene understanding since these operations run locally on the device. However, multiplayer AR features and cloud-based object detection require internet connectivity.

HTC Vive: What play space size does HTC Vive require?

HTC Vive requires a dedicated play area to take full advantage of room-scale VR. The system requires setting up and defining your play area during setup, which necessitates significant floor space (typically minimum 6x6 feet for basic play, more for optimal experience).

ARKit: Does ARKit integrate with game engines?

Yes, ARKit integrates with Unity through the Unity ARKit Plugin and with Unreal Engine. Developers can also use it with Metal, SceneKit, and Apple's RealityKit framework.

ARKit: What are ARKit's limitations with location-based AR?

ARKit's location-based positioning has accuracy limitations. Image-based positioning is primarily useful in urban areas, and beacon-based navigation provides accuracy of 3-5 meters, which is insufficient for precise AR applications requiring 1-meter accuracy or better.
